About This Property
Newly renovated townhouse style apartment in charming community of Lookout Ridge. Featuring 2 bedrooms, 1.5 baths this unit offers open concept first floor with galley kitchen,master bedroom with walkout to private balcony. Conveniently located to schools, shopping and dining. Assigned off-street parking. Small pets will be considered. Available for immediate occupancy. Tenant pays all utilities.
2609 Crisnic Ct is a townhome located in Kenton County and the 41014 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Covington Independent attendance zone.

Northern Kentucky is a sprawling region located just south of Cincinnati, Ohio. The Ohio River hugs the northern, eastern, and western portions of the region, serving as a scenic destination for all kinds of outdoor recreation throughout the year. Florence, Dayton, Newport, Covington, Burlington, and Highland Heights are among the many communities included in the Northern Kentucky region.
Each community in Northern Kentucky offers its own unique identity and sense of character. The rentals in the area are just as diverse as Northern Kentucky itself, ranging from luxury apartments to charming houses and everything in between. Getting around the region is a breeze with convenience to Interstates 71, 75, 275, and 471.
